Virtual reality also offers an affordable alternative to live training for a range of occupations. Commercial pilots are able to use realistic cockpits with this kind of technology to teach. Holistic training programs can also incorporate equally live exercising and electronic flight. Doctors can practice with digital instruments and patients, and police officers and soldiers may conduct lab-created raids devoid of risking lives.
